git的常见操作

首先git bash的安装   (这个就不做过多的描述了,具体的在官网下载就行)

1.拉去别人的项目

命令:git clone 别人的项目路径

一般来讲git clone的项目路径有2中http的和ssh的

区别:

       ssh的需要在本地建立秘钥(听说是安全性要高点)

       在本地新建的命令 ssh-keygen -t dsa

       id_dsa         -->私钥(钥匙)

       id_dsa.pub     -->公钥(锁)

  http相对简单点

     当项目要push上仓库的时候会弹出要输入用户名和密码,填对就能进去了

2.第一次提交项目(代码仓库是新建的啥都没)

如果提交不成功可能的2中情况

1.没有git add -A  和 git commit -m "说明" 没有将代码保存在本地库(需要执行前面2句代码)

2.如遇到其他情况直接add和commit之后强制提交具体命令git push -u origin master -f 

 

说明:本人项目做得都比较小  基本上算是自己一个人来维护git库  所以该篇没有相应的分支操作!!!

 

继续

git status 命令用于显示工作目录和暂存区的状态

版本回退

git log 查看commit版本号  回退的关键  

git reset --hard  查到的版本号  

以上基本上算是平时最常见的git操作了(这些基本能解决日常项目中的问题)  深入的需要看廖雪峰官网   

 

基本的上传流程

git add -A   (他会把工作时所有变化提交到暂存区)

git commit -m "updata"  (主要是将暂存区里的改动给提交到本地的版本库,对于后期回退起到关键作用)

git pull  (一般要先把别人的拉取下来合并  并且检查冲突)

git push 

基本的拉取流程

git add -A

git commit -m "updata"

git pull

 

更新:切换分支提交什么的

在你修改之后必须git add -A 和git commit -m "updata" 保存到本地仓库

主分支:master 其他分支dev

git branch//查看当前分支名称

git checkout dev//切换当前分支为dev

git pull origin dev //拉取dev分支上面他人更新的内容

git push origiin dev //提交当前更新到dev分支

ok!! //2019-8-30

 

更新:查看当前源和其他操作

git remote -v  查看当前项目关联的源

git remote add origin "url地址"  添加关联的源

如果git  remote -v 的输出结果什么都没有的话可以用当前这句话把当前项目绑定到指定的仓库

git remote remove origin 删除当前绑定的源

如果报错  可能是当前项目的.git文件夹没生成

需要git init 生成.git文件夹

ok!! //2019-9-12

 

 

 

 

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值